Malspam distributing AgentTesla:

HELO: brembanarolle.com
Sending IP: 45.153.240.130
From: Miss Loretta Cook <info@brembanarolle.com>
Subject: Urgent Request
Attachment: New Order.r00 (contains "#New Order.exe")

AgentTesla SMTP exfil server:
mail.mybutler.in:587
